摘要
We propose a comprehensive model in which we examine the process of gas outflow by an evolved star (post-AGB stars) and the subsequent circumstellar shell formation. First, we investigate the buoyant transport of an isolated toroidlike tube through the red-giant convective envelope, originating from the innermost regions of the star and composed of strongly magnetized gas. When carrying up to a position immediately above the stellar surface, such a tube is no longer confined by the gas pressure existing throughout the red-giant envelope and consequently expands. It is hypothesized that the confluence of such magnetized tubes can produce a disklike structure of cool matter which surrounds the star. We have also analyzed the blowing process by a fast wind of the early ejected cool matter. The large- and small-scale structures of the preplanetary nebula shell such as the bipolarity, the filamentary pattern, and the multiple-shell appearance are then discussed. A critical comparison with other concurrent models (Balick et al. 1987; Soker and Livio 1989; Morris 1990) are also summarily presented.
